Comprendre la boucle : Un guide complet

C’est quoi la boucle ?
1. Anneau ou rectangle de métal avec traverse portant en général un ou plusieurs ardillons, qui sert à assujettir les deux extrémités d’une courroie, d’une ceinture, etc. 2. Mèche de cheveux roulée sur elle-même.
En savoir plus sur www.larousse.fr


En tant que programmeur, vous avez peut-être entendu le terme « boucle » assez fréquemment. Mais qu’est-ce qu’une boucle exactement, et comment fonctionne-t-elle ? En termes simples, une boucle est une construction de programmation qui vous permet de répéter un ensemble d’instructions plusieurs fois jusqu’à ce qu’une certaine condition soit remplie. Cette condition est généralement définie par le programmeur et peut aller d’un nombre spécifique d’itérations à l’atteinte d’une certaine valeur.


Une utilisation courante des boucles consiste à additionner une colonne avec une condition. Par exemple, si vous disposez d’un tableau de données de vente et que vous souhaitez additionner les ventes totales d’un vendeur spécifique, vous pouvez utiliser une boucle pour parcourir chaque ligne du tableau et additionner les ventes de cette personne. Pour ce faire en VBA, vous devez d’abord définir une variable qui contiendra le total des ventes, puis utiliser une boucle pour parcourir chaque ligne et additionner les ventes de la personne spécifiée.


En VBA, l’initialisation d’un tableau est un processus simple. Vous pouvez soit déclarer un tableau et lui attribuer directement des valeurs, soit utiliser une boucle pour remplir le tableau de valeurs. Pour déclarer un tableau, vous utilisez l’instruction Dim suivie du nom du tableau et de ses dimensions. Par exemple, Dim monTableau(10) déclare un tableau de 11 éléments (indexés de 0 à 10). Pour remplir le tableau de valeurs, vous pouvez utiliser une boucle pour assigner des valeurs à chaque élément.


L’utilisation de tableaux en VBA peut être un outil puissant pour manipuler des données. Une fois que vous avez initialisé un tableau, vous pouvez l’utiliser pour stocker et manipuler de grandes quantités de données rapidement et efficacement. Vous pouvez également utiliser des boucles pour parcourir un tableau et effectuer des opérations sur chaque élément.

En SQL, les boucles sont généralement créées à l’aide d’une boucle WHILE ou d’une boucle FOR. Une boucle WHILE est utilisée pour répéter un ensemble d’instructions tant qu’une certaine condition est remplie. Par exemple, vous pouvez utiliser une boucle WHILE pour parcourir une table et effectuer une opération sur chaque ligne jusqu’à ce qu’une certaine valeur soit atteinte. Une boucle FOR est utilisée pour parcourir un ensemble de valeurs un certain nombre de fois. Par exemple, vous pouvez utiliser une boucle FOR pour parcourir un ensemble de dates et effectuer une opération sur chacune d’entre elles.

En conclusion, les boucles sont une construction de programmation fondamentale qui vous permet de répéter un ensemble d’instructions plusieurs fois jusqu’à ce qu’une certaine condition soit remplie. Elles sont couramment utilisées pour manipuler des données, itérer dans des tableaux et effectuer des opérations sur des tables de base de données. En comprenant comment utiliser efficacement les boucles, vous pouvez écrire un code plus efficace et plus puissant, capable de traiter de grandes quantités de données rapidement et avec précision.

FAQ
Comment mettre en pause une macro Excel ?

Pour mettre en pause une macro Excel, vous pouvez utiliser le code VBA « Application.Wait » suivi de la durée souhaitée en secondes ou en millisecondes. Par exemple, le code « Application.Wait Now + TimeValue(« 00:00:05″) » mettra la macro en pause pendant 5 secondes. Vous pouvez également utiliser la fonction « Sleep » de l’API Windows pour mettre la macro en pause pendant un nombre spécifique de millisecondes. Toutefois, il est important de noter que la mise en pause d’une macro doit être effectuée avec parcimonie et uniquement dans un but précis, car elle peut avoir un impact négatif sur l’expérience de l’utilisateur et les performances de la macro.

Comment créer une boucle en C ?

Pour créer une boucle en C, plusieurs options sont disponibles, notamment la boucle for, la boucle while et la boucle do-while. Voici un exemple de boucle for qui imprime les nombres de 1 à 10 :

« `

for (int i = 1 ; i <= 10 ; i++) {

printf(« %d « , i) ;

}

« `

Cette boucle initialise la variable `i` à 1, vérifie si `i` est inférieur ou égal à 10, exécute le corps de la boucle (en imprimant la valeur de `i`) et incrémente ensuite `i` de 1. Cette boucle s’exécutera 10 fois, en imprimant les nombres de 1 à 10.


Laisser un commentaire